Summary The position is located in AHF-400, Benefits Operations Center (BOC). The BOC is a nationwide benefits/retirement center for all FAA employees. The Human Resources Assistant (HRA) answers daily calls and emails averaging 30-50 inquiries per week. The HRA processes retirement/benefits actions, develop and present benefits education information such as New Employee Orientation, Open Season and other topics throughout the year. Responsibilities The HR Assistant performs a combination of routine, multiple and varying assignments in support of HR professionals in the Benefits Operations Center under the limited direction of a manager, team leader, or more experienced employee. The HRA assists managers and other employees in day-to-day operations, and may act as a lead for other support staff to coordinate multiple assignments. The incumbent applies experience and advance knowledge of Federal retirement programs and benefits to plan, perform and accomplish administrative assignments for projects/programs. The Assistant has a broad understanding of how retirement/benefits actions and administrative assignments contribute to the Divisions activities and how providing customer service support to the FAA employees is a essential function of the BOC. Under limited supervision and in support of experienced professionals the incumbent assignments include: Provides technical assistance to employees on information concerning retirement benefits, disability, or other types of employee benefit programs such as FEHB, FEGLI, TSP, BENEFEDS, FSAFEDS, etc. Compiles, tracks, and analyzes employees personnel data; Conducts thorough reviews of employee personnel information/service history, completes deposit/redeposit estimates and retirement estimates. Maintains complete record of work in electronic case management system. Provides written or oral explanations of information requested; Maintains files/records; assists with the coordination of new office policies and systems. Use various automated systems such as FHR (Retirement Calculator), Microsoft Office, Outlook, HR Case Management System, Avaya phone system, etc. Adhere to daily assigned phone schedule in responding to calls from FAA employees nationwide. Demonstrates considerable independence in planning time, and coordinates only as needed with a manager, team leader, or more experienced employee to prioritize assignments and use assigned resources. Helps others plan and identify resources to accomplish projects/programs/tasks. Contacts are internal and external. Internal contacts frequently involve managers, employees from more than one organizational unit, major subdivision, and/or LOB/SO to share information, coordinate efforts, and discuss the statuses of assignments. External contacts are with customers and other parties on routine matters that relate to the HR professionals that are being supported. Established policies/procedures provide guidance for most assignments, but allow some discretion for the employee to select the most appropriate approach(es) or to recommend a new approach(es). The manager or more experienced employee provides instructions when needed and receives recommendation/input from the Assistant to improve work process. Processes federal benefits elections following appropriate regulatory guidelines, including those of an unusually complicated nature, within established timeframes. Provides guidance to lower level support staff members for handling routine problems and issues. Assures completeness of files. Responds to phone/email inquiries, determines nature of request and directs to the appropriate staff member, as needed. Identifies and informs the managers and/or other employees of problems/issues that require their attention. Work is reviewed periodically through status reports and at completion, to ensure policy compliance and alignment with the requirements of projects and/or work activities. Work activities typically support multiple projects/programs and contribute to the objectives of one or more organizational units and/or major subdivisions. Qualifications To qualify for this position at the FV-E level: You must demonstrate in your application that you possess at least one year of specialized experience equivalent to FV-D, FG/GS-3/6. Specialized experience is experience that has equipped you with the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ities to perform successfully the duties of the position. Specialized experience includes: Experience compiling, tracking, and analyzing personnel data, Experience with using an automated system to process personnel actions, Experience with providing customer service support by answering calls and responding to emails. To qualify for this position at the FV-F level: You must demonstrate in your application that you possess at least 1 year of specialized experience equivalent to the FV-E, (FG/GS-7-8) level. Specialized experience includes: Experience compiling, tracking, and analyzing personnel data, Experience with using an automated system to process personnel actions, Experience with providing customer service support by answering calls and responding to emails. Qualification requirements must be met by the closing date of this vacancy announcement. Education No education substitution for qualifications for this position.
